[英]Can I control how many loops in a ES6 forEach loop
I have created a simple api call using XMLHttpRequest 我已经使用XMLHttpRequest创建了一个简单的api调用
I have the json back and displaying it within a ES6 forEach loop. 我将json返回并显示在ES6 forEach循环中。
The returning data has 100 items but I only want to show the first 10 返回的数据有100个项目,但我只想显示前10个项目
Can I use the ES6 forEach loop like a for loop like 我可以像for循环一样使用ES6 forEach循环吗
for(let i=0; i<10; i++)
to loop 10 times. 循环十次。
You can use slice()
to get required part of array and then use forEach
. 您可以使用
slice()
获取数组的必需部分,然后使用forEach
。 Considering your variable name is array
you can do like below. 考虑到变量名是
array
您可以执行以下操作。
array.slice(0,10).forEach(...)
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.